在前端开发的世界里,插件就像是一把神奇的钥匙,可以帮助我们打开效率提升的大门。今天,我们就来聊聊前端插件那些事儿,看看如何通过这些小小的工具,让我们的开发工作变得更加轻松愉快。
前端插件的作用
前端插件是针对前端开发过程中的某些特定需求而设计的工具。它们可以简化开发流程,提高代码质量,甚至帮助我们解决一些棘手的问题。以下是前端插件的一些主要作用:
- 提高开发效率:通过自动化某些重复性任务,插件可以节省大量的时间和精力。
- 增强用户体验:插件可以增强网页的功能性,提升用户体验。
- 解决兼容性问题:有些插件可以帮助解决不同浏览器之间的兼容性问题。
- 丰富项目功能:插件可以让我们在不编写额外代码的情况下,为项目添加新的功能。
实用技巧分享
1. 选择合适的插件
在选择前端插件时,我们需要注意以下几点:
- 兼容性:确保插件与你的项目所使用的框架和库兼容。
- 稳定性:选择那些口碑好、更新频繁的插件。
- 易用性:插件的操作界面应该简单易懂。
2. 插件集成
将插件集成到项目中时,我们可以遵循以下步骤:
- 安装插件:根据插件的安装说明,使用npm、yarn或其他工具进行安装。
- 配置插件:根据插件的文档,进行相应的配置。
- 使用插件:在项目中引入插件,并按照文档中的说明使用。
3. 插件优化
在使用插件的过程中,我们可以通过以下方式对其进行优化:
- 性能优化:针对插件加载速度和运行效率进行优化。
- 代码优化:对插件的代码进行重构,提高代码质量。
案例分析
下面,我们来分析几个常见的前端插件案例:
1. Vue.js 框架中的插件
Vue.js 是一个流行的前端框架,其官方提供了一系列插件,如路由管理插件 Vue Router、状态管理插件 Vuex 等。这些插件可以帮助我们快速搭建 Vue.js 项目,提高开发效率。
2. Element UI 组件库
Element UI 是一个基于 Vue.js 的 UI 组件库,提供了丰富的组件和工具,可以帮助我们快速搭建美观、易用的网页界面。
3. Axios HTTP 客户端
Axios 是一个基于 Promise 的 HTTP 客户端,可以帮助我们轻松实现 HTTP 请求。它支持多种请求方法,如 GET、POST、PUT、DELETE 等,并且具有请求取消、响应拦截等功能。
总结
前端插件是提升开发效率的重要工具,合理使用插件可以让我们的工作更加轻松。在选择、集成和优化插件的过程中,我们需要注意兼容性、稳定性、易用性等因素。通过学习这些实用技巧和案例分析,相信你能够在前端开发的道路上越走越远。
